Sydney - From Settlement to the Bridge by Ian Collis is a richly illustrated pictorial history that traces the remarkable transformation of Sydney from a small colonial outpost into one of the world's most recognisable harbour cities. Published in 2007 by Martin Ford Publishers, the book presents a vivid visual chronicle of the city's development through carefully selected historical photographs, engravings and archival material. Ian Collis, known for his accessible Australian history titles and strong interest in transport and urban heritage, brings together an engaging narrative that captures the architectural, social and cultural evolution of Sydney across more than a century of growth.

Focusing particularly on the period leading to the construction of the iconic Sydney Harbour Bridge, Sydney - From Settlement to the Bridge documents the dramatic changes that reshaped the city during the nineteenth and early twentieth centuries. The book explores early colonial settlement, waterfront activity, public transport, street life, commerce and the expansion of infrastructure that transformed Sydney into a modern metropolis. The extensive photographic content gives readers a fascinating glimpse into vanished streetscapes, historic buildings and everyday life in earlier eras, making the volume especially appealing to local historians, collectors and enthusiasts of Australian urban history.

Beautifully produced and highly readable, Sydney - From Settlement to the Bridge functions both as an informative historical survey and as an evocative visual record of Australia's oldest major city.
